Seeking Mentorship from Experienced Leaders

Leadership development coaching is a valuable tool for individuals looking to enhance their skills and reach their full potential in their careers. One of the most effective ways to maximize the benefits of leadership development coaching is by seeking mentorship from experienced leaders. By networking with seasoned professionals in your field, you can gain valuable insights, guidance, and support that can help you grow as a leader.

Mentorship is a powerful tool for personal and professional growth. Experienced leaders have a wealth of knowledge and experience that they can share with those who are just starting out or looking to advance in their careers. By seeking out a mentor, you can tap into this valuable resource and learn from someone who has been where you are and achieved success.

Networking is key to finding a mentor who can help you on your leadership development journey. Attend industry events, join professional organizations, and connect with leaders in your field through social media platforms like LinkedIn. By building relationships with experienced professionals, you can increase your chances of finding a mentor who can provide you with the guidance and support you need to succeed.

When seeking a mentor, it’s important to be proactive and approach potential mentors with a clear idea of what you hope to gain from the relationship. Be respectful of their time and expertise, and be open to feedback and constructive criticism. A good mentor will challenge you to grow and push you out of your comfort zone, helping you to develop new skills and perspectives.

Once you have found a mentor, make the most of your time together by setting clear goals and objectives for your mentorship relationship. Be open and honest about your strengths and weaknesses, and be willing to take on new challenges and opportunities for growth. Your mentor can help you identify areas for improvement and provide you with the support and guidance you need to reach your full potential as a leader.
